Lead Electrical and Controls Engineer


Lead innovation and reliability in a fast-paced bakery manufacturing environment

We’re looking for a skilled and driven Lead Electrical and Controls Engineer to join our Engineering team in Milton Keynes. This is a fantastic opportunity to take ownership of electrical systems and automation across a 24/7 bakery manufacturing site, acting as the site’s Electrical Duty Holder and technical lead for controls and automation.

In this role, you’ll be responsible for maintaining electrical installations to the highest standards, leading PLC and automation projects, and developing the technical capabilities of the wider engineering team. You’ll play a key part in ensuring our production lines run safely, efficiently, and with minimal downtime.

What you’ll be doing:

  • Acting as the site’s Electrical Duty Holder, ensuring compliance with all statutory requirements.
  • Leading troubleshooting and continuous improvement of electrical and control systems.
  • Designing, programming, and fault-finding PLCs, HMIs, AC drives, and servo controls.
  • Coaching and mentoring engineers in electrical fault-finding and controls.
  • Managing technical documentation and standardising control components across the site.

What we’re looking for:

  • Time-served apprenticeship with HNC or equivalent (Degree desirable).
  • Strong electrical knowledge, ideally with 18th Edition certification.
  • Proven experience in automation and controls within a manufacturing environment.
  • Ability to write and troubleshoot PLC and HMI code.
  • A proactive, self-starting mindset with strong problem-solving skills.

About the company

Lantmännen Unibake is a leading global bakery company within the Lantmännen Group. With expertise in bakery products for food service and retail, we serve consumers around the clock and across the world every day. The aim is to make bread and pastry a profitable business for our customers through tasty, high-quality products and innovative solutions and based on a sustainable mind-set and excellent food safety standards. Headquartered in Copenhagen, Denmark, Lantmännen Unibake operates modern bakeries around the world and has sales in more than 60 countries. The brand portfolio comprises a range of well-established B2B and BtC brands e.g. Schulstad Bakery Solutions, Schulstad, Bonjour, Vaasan, Pastridor and Hatting.
